    1. Work Authorization

    Before starting any high-risk task, obtaining proper work authorization is crucial. This isn't just about filling out a form; it's a comprehensive process that ensures the task is well-planned, the risks are identified, and the necessary precautions are in place. The work authorization process typically involves several steps. First, a detailed risk assessment is conducted to identify all potential hazards associated with the task. This assessment considers factors such as the environment, the equipment being used, and the skills of the personnel involved. Once the risks are identified, appropriate control measures are developed to mitigate them. These measures might include using personal protective equipment (PPE), implementing lockout-tagout procedures, or establishing safe work zones. Next, a work permit is issued, documenting the task, the risks, and the control measures. This permit must be reviewed and approved by authorized personnel, ensuring that all aspects of the task have been carefully considered. The permit also serves as a communication tool, informing all involved parties of the potential hazards and the precautions they need to take. Before work begins, a pre-job briefing is held to review the work permit and ensure that everyone understands their roles and responsibilities. This briefing provides an opportunity to ask questions and clarify any uncertainties. Throughout the task, ongoing monitoring is essential to ensure that the control measures remain effective. If conditions change or new hazards are identified, the work permit must be revised accordingly. Upon completion of the task, a post-job review is conducted to evaluate the effectiveness of the work authorization process and identify any areas for improvement. This review helps to refine the process and ensure that it remains relevant and effective.     2. Lockout Tagout (LOTO)

    Lockout Tagout (LOTO) is all about controlling hazardous energy. Imagine working on a machine that could unexpectedly start up – scary, right? LOTO ensures that dangerous equipment is properly isolated before maintenance or repairs. LOTO procedures are designed to prevent the accidental release of hazardous energy, which can cause serious injuries or fatalities. These procedures involve isolating the energy source, locking it out with a physical device, and tagging it to indicate that the equipment is out of service. The process begins with identifying all potential sources of hazardous energy, such as electrical, mechanical, hydraulic, pneumatic, thermal, and chemical. Each energy source must be properly isolated using lockout devices, such as padlocks, valve lockout devices, and circuit breaker lockouts. These devices prevent the energy source from being reactivated until the lockout device is removed. In addition to lockout devices, tagout devices are used to provide a visual warning that the equipment is out of service. These tags typically include information about the reason for the lockout, the date and time of the lockout, and the name of the person who applied the lockout. Before applying lockout-tagout, it's essential to notify all affected employees and ensure that the equipment is properly shut down. The equipment must then be isolated and de-energized. Once the lockout-tagout devices are in place, the equipment must be tested to verify that it is indeed de-energized and safe to work on. During maintenance or repair work, it's crucial to ensure that the lockout-tagout devices remain in place. Any changes to the lockout-tagout configuration must be carefully documented and communicated to all affected employees. Once the work is complete, the equipment must be inspected to ensure that it is safe to return to service. The lockout-tagout devices can then be removed by the person who applied them. After removing the lockout-tagout devices, it's important to notify all affected employees that the equipment is back in service.     3. Confined Space Entry

    Confined spaces can be deadly. These are areas not designed for continuous occupancy, like tanks or pipelines, and they often have hazardous atmospheres. Confined Space Entry rules ensure proper testing, ventilation, and rescue plans are in place before anyone enters. Confined spaces pose a variety of hazards, including oxygen deficiency, toxic gases, flammable vapors, and physical hazards such as engulfment or entrapment. These hazards can quickly lead to serious injuries or fatalities if proper precautions are not taken. Confined Space Entry procedures are designed to mitigate these risks and ensure the safety of workers who must enter these spaces. The process begins with identifying all confined spaces and assessing the hazards they pose. This assessment includes evaluating the atmosphere, the physical characteristics of the space, and the potential for engulfment or entrapment. Once the hazards are identified, a Confined Space Entry permit is required before anyone can enter the space. This permit documents the hazards, the control measures that will be implemented, and the roles and responsibilities of the personnel involved. Before entering the confined space, the atmosphere must be tested to ensure that it is safe. This testing includes measuring the oxygen level, the concentration of toxic gases, and the presence of flammable vapors. If the atmosphere is not safe, ventilation must be provided to remove the hazards. In addition to atmospheric testing, other control measures may be necessary, such as isolating the space from potential sources of hazardous energy, providing fall protection, and ensuring proper communication. A trained attendant must be stationed outside the confined space to monitor the workers inside and provide assistance in case of an emergency. The attendant must be equipped with a means of communication and a rescue plan. If a worker inside the confined space encounters a problem, the attendant must be able to initiate a rescue. Rescue procedures must be carefully planned and practiced to ensure that they can be carried out quickly and effectively. After the work is complete, the confined space must be inspected to ensure that it is safe to return to normal operations. The Confined Space Entry permit can then be closed out.     4. Working at Heights

    Working at heights is inherently risky. Falls are a leading cause of workplace injuries, so strict rules are in place to prevent them. This includes using fall protection equipment, like harnesses and guardrails, and ensuring proper training. Working at heights poses a significant risk of falls, which can result in serious injuries or fatalities. To mitigate this risk, strict rules and procedures must be followed. These rules typically include the use of fall protection equipment, such as harnesses, lanyards, and lifelines, as well as the implementation of engineering controls, such as guardrails and safety nets. Before working at heights, a hazard assessment must be conducted to identify all potential fall hazards. This assessment should consider factors such as the height of the work area, the stability of the work surface, and the presence of any obstructions or hazards. Based on the hazard assessment, appropriate fall protection measures must be implemented. These measures may include the use of personal fall arrest systems, which consist of a harness, a lanyard, and an anchor point. The harness must be properly fitted and adjusted to ensure that it will effectively arrest a fall. The lanyard must be of the appropriate length and must be attached to a secure anchor point. In addition to personal fall arrest systems, engineering controls can also be used to prevent falls. Guardrails can be installed around elevated work areas to prevent workers from falling off the edge. Safety nets can be used to catch workers if they do fall. Proper training is essential to ensure that workers understand the risks of working at heights and how to use fall protection equipment properly. This training should cover topics such as hazard identification, fall protection techniques, and emergency procedures. Regular inspections of fall protection equipment are also necessary to ensure that it is in good working order. Any damaged or defective equipment must be removed from service immediately.     5. Safe Driving

    Given that many Ienergy Canada employees are on the road, safe driving practices are paramount. This means adhering to speed limits, avoiding distractions like cell phones, and ensuring vehicles are properly maintained. Safe driving practices are essential for preventing accidents and protecting the lives of drivers and other road users. These practices include obeying traffic laws, maintaining a safe following distance, avoiding distractions, and ensuring that vehicles are properly maintained. One of the most important aspects of safe driving is obeying traffic laws. This includes adhering to speed limits, stopping at red lights and stop signs, and yielding the right-of-way. Speeding is a major cause of accidents, so it's crucial to drive at a safe speed for the conditions. Maintaining a safe following distance is also essential for preventing accidents. This allows drivers enough time to react to unexpected events, such as sudden stops or changes in traffic flow. A good rule of thumb is to maintain at least three seconds of following distance. Avoiding distractions is another key component of safe driving. Distractions can include cell phones, food, and other passengers. Cell phones are a particularly dangerous distraction, as they can take a driver's attention away from the road for several seconds at a time. It's best to avoid using cell phones while driving altogether. Ensuring that vehicles are properly maintained is also important for safe driving. This includes regularly checking the tires, brakes, lights, and other essential components. Properly maintained vehicles are less likely to experience mechanical failures that could lead to accidents. In addition to these practices, it's also important to be aware of the conditions and adjust driving accordingly. This includes driving slower in rain, snow, or fog, and being extra cautious at night.
